Ingredients
- 2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1 stick (½ cup) unsalted butter
- 2 (10.5-ounce) cans condensed cream of chicken soup
- 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 12 ounces dry wide egg noodles
- Salt and black pepper, to taste (optional)
Optional Add-Ins
- ½ cup sour cream or a splash of heavy cream for extra richness
- 1–2 cups frozen peas and carrots or mixed vegetables
- Grated Parmesan cheese for serving
Instructions
Step 1: Layer the Chicken
Arrange the chicken breasts in a single layer in the bottom of a 6-quart slow cooker.
Step 2: Add the Soup
Spread the condensed cream of chicken soup evenly over the chicken, covering it as much as possible.
Step 3: Pour in the Broth
Add the chicken broth around and over the soup mixture to create a creamy cooking sauce.
Step 4: Add the Butter
Place the whole stick of butter directly on top of the chicken and soup mixture.
Step 5: Slow Cook
Cover with the lid and cook:
- LOW: 5–6 hours
- HIGH: 2½–3 hours
The chicken should be tender enough to shred easily.
Step 6: Shred the Chicken
Transfer the cooked chicken to a cutting board and shred it into bite-sized pieces using two forks.
Step 7: Return to the Slow Cooker
Stir the shredded chicken back into the creamy sauce until everything is well combined.
Step 8: Cook the Noodles
Add the dry egg noodles directly to the slow cooker. Stir to coat them in the sauce, adding a little extra broth or water if needed so the noodles are mostly submerged.
Cover and cook on HIGH for 20–30 minutes, stirring once halfway through, until the noodles are tender.
Step 9: Finish and Serve
Taste and season with salt and pepper if desired. Let the dish rest for about 5 minutes to thicken before serving warm.
